Job Title

Staff Engineer, Analog/Mixed-Signal Design

Role Summary

This role leads design and development of analog and mixed-signal integrated circuits for battery monitoring in the Automotive Electrification Business Unit. The engineer will drive circuit architecture, silicon bring-up, and cross-functional collaboration to deliver safe, reliable battery management solutions.

Primary focus areas include ADCs, references, oscillators, power converters, and functional-safety integration for automotive battery-monitoring systems.

Experience Level

Senior level β€” typically 8+ years of relevant analog and mixed-signal IC design experience.

Responsibilities

The role requires technical leadership across design, verification, test, and system teams plus hands-on circuit development and silicon debug.

  • Lead analog and mixed-signal circuit architecture and detailed design for BMS applications (ADCs, references, oscillators, power converters).
  • Define and apply functional-safety requirements and collaborate with safety teams to meet ISO26262 expectations.
  • Perform silicon evaluation, debug, failure analysis, and support test characterization.
  • Drive design reviews, maintain high-quality design practices, and ensure requirements traceability and documentation.
  • Collaborate with layout, verification, test, applications, and systems engineering to resolve integration issues.
  • Provide technical leadership and mentorship to engineers and contribute to continuous improvement of analog design methods.

Requirements

Must-have technical skills, experience, and responsibilities.

  • 8+ years of hands-on analog and mixed-signal IC design experience (precision signal-chain blocks and system-level tradeoffs).
  • Strong expertise in precision analog circuits, noise management, signal integrity, and power-domain crossings.
  • Practical awareness of layout-sensitive analog design: matching, parasitics, shielding, isolation, and floor-planning impacts.
  • Experience with silicon bring-up, debug, test characterization, and failure analysis.
  • Proven ability to lead cross-functional teams, perform design reviews, and mentor junior engineers.
  • Familiarity with ISO26262 functional safety concepts and ability to incorporate safety into product design.
  • Effective documentation and requirements-traceability practices for regulated or safety-related products.
  • Willingness to travel ~10% for collaboration and validation activities.

Nice-to-have:

  • Specific experience with ADC design, on-chip references, oscillator design, or power converter circuits for automotive applications.
  • Prior work on battery management systems or automotive electrification products.

Education Requirements

MS or PhD in Electrical Engineering.


About the Company

Company: Analog Devices

Headquarters: Norwood, Massachusetts, USA

Analog Devices is a leading global semiconductor company that bridges the physical and digital worlds, enabling breakthroughs at the Intelligent Edge. With a focus on innovation, ADI develops solutions that drive advancements in digitized factories, mobility, and digital healthcare. The company employs around 24,000 people globally and reported revenues exceeding $9 billion in FY24, creating technologies that transform lives across various sectors.
